Troubleshooting Common CNC Drilling Problems

Experiencing difficulties with your CNC boring machine? Several typical problems can hinder productivity. One key area to check is the rotating tool itself; dull bits cause unsatisfactory hole quality and chatter. here Furthermore , ensure the material is securely clamped to the table to prevent shifting . Feed rates and spindle speeds might need modification based on the stock being processed ; too high a rate can lead to tool breakage . Finally, verify your programming for errors; even a small mistake can cause inaccurate hole placement .

Drilling Machine Upkeep : Best Guidelines

To maintain consistent operation of your CNC drilling machine , scheduled care is critically vital . Daily checks of oil levels, cutting fluid condition, and debris clearing are vital . Moreover, periodic washing of air systems and electrical components enables minimize malfunctions and increases machine longevity . Finally , sticking to the maker’s instructions for preventative servicing is imperative for long-term output.
